Bethel Warriors claim podium at Valdez XC Invitational

High school and middle school boys get ready at the starting line of the Valdez Cross Country Invitational last Saturday. Teams from Bethel, Cordova, Unalaska, and Valdez participated in the event. Photos courtesy of Paul Saltzman

by Delta Discovery Staff

The Bethel Cross Country Team won both the girls and boys divisions at the Valdez Cross Country Invitational this past weekend, August 17th. They also took the top three spots on the podium. Teams participating included Bethel, Cordova, Unalaska, and the host team the Valdez Buccaneers.

Winning the girls division was freshman Claire Dyment of Bethel. She finished the 5K course with a time of 23:14. Her sister Rosemarie Dyment, a junior, came in second at 23:28. Sophomore Kayleigh Bell, also of Bethel, finished in third. Her time was 24:03.

Four other Lady Warriors finished in the top ten: freshman Sally Peters placed 5th, senior Kyana Harpak came in 6th, sophomore Riley Boney 7th, and freshmen Kaitlyn Wade cracked the top 10 in 10th place.

The Bethel Warrior boys also swept the podium with senior Ned Peters winning the gold medal (16:32), sophomore Jackson Iverson placed second (17:26), and his brother Cole Iverson, a freshman, won third place (17:40).

Other Warriors also finished in the top 12: sophomore Ethan Wheeler finished in 5th, senior Sheldon Smith placed 6th, senior Madden Cockroft placed 9th, and sophomore Aiden Crow finished in 12th place.

Runners started the 5K course on the East Dike of Mineral Creek. They ran up Cullen’s Hill to Mineral Creek Road where they crossed a bridge that bounces when running. Racers then ran up Mighty Might to a small water crossing towards the turn around point. At 2.5 km, runners made a large arc on the road before returning to the starting line.

Race organizers also hosted a community race after the combined high school and middle school race. The day’s events concluded with an awards ceremony at the high school cafeteria.
